Comprehending Composite Doors
Before delving into the refinishing procedure, it's vital to comprehend what makes composite doors distinct. Unlike traditional wooden or metal doors, composite doors are made from a mix of products, including:
- PVC: For weather resistance and insulation.
- Wood fibers: For included strength and aesthetic appeals.
- Glass-reinforced plastic (GRP): For a robust exterior.
- Steel or aluminum: For extra security.
These products combined make composite door specialist doors highly resistant to warping, rotting, and fading compared to their wooden counterparts. Nevertheless, they might need periodic refinishing to maintain their appearance.

The Refinishing Process
Refinishing a composite door can be an uncomplicated job if approached correctly. Here's a detailed breakdown of the steps included:
1. Preparation
- Gather Materials: You will need sandpaper, a soft fabric, primer, paint or stain, a clear sealer, security goggles, and gloves.
- Tidy the Door: Start by cleaning the door thoroughly to eliminate dirt, grime, and any existing surfaces. Usage moderate soap and water, and dry the door completely before carrying on.
2. Sanding
- Sand the Surface: Use a proper grit sandpaper (typically in between 120-220 grit) to gently sand the surface area of the door. This creates a rough texture for the new finish to adhere much better.
- Dust Removal: After sanding, rub out any dust with a clean cloth or tack cloth to avoid imperfections in the brand-new finishing.
3. Priming
- Apply Primer: If you're changing the color of your door or the existing finish is greatly used, use a guide created for composite garage door repair materials. This step may not be essential for small touch-ups but is a good idea for considerable color changes.
4. Painting/Staining
- Pick Your Finish: Select a paint or stain particularly produced composite surface areas. Be sure it appropriates for outdoor use and supplies UV protection.
- Application: Use a brush or roller to apply the finish evenly. Depending on the item, numerous coats might be needed, so check the manufacturer's instructions.
5. Sealing
- Include a Clear Sealant: To secure your refinished door, use a clear sealant once the paint or stain has dried totally. This includes an additional layer of security versus wetness and UV damage.
- Last Drying: Allow the door to dry entirely per the maker's recommendations before re-hanging or exposing it to the components.
Tips for Successful Refinishing
- Choose the Right Weather: For the best results, refinish during dry weather to ensure appropriate drying and treating.
- Test Colors: Before dedicating to a complete door application, test your selected color in a little location.
- Wear Protective Gear: Safety safety glasses and gloves secure versus dust and chemicals during the refinishing procedure.
- Regular Maintenance: Regular cleaning and assessment can lengthen the life of your door, decreasing the requirement for future refinishing.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How often should I refinish my composite door?
Composite doors typically need refinishing every 3 to 5 years, depending upon exposure to the elements and use.
2. Can I utilize conventional wood paints on a composite door?
It is suggested to utilize paint or stain particular to replace composite door materials developed to adhere properly and offer lasting results.

3. Is professional refinishing worth it?
While DIY refinishing can be reliable, employing experts can ensure a perfect finish and is recommended for those unsure about the process.
